
Case Study:
ITSM Transformation for a Leading NHS Trust
Introduction
A prominent NHS Trust required a modern, scalable IT Service Management (ITSM) solution to replace its legacy system, which was due for decommissioning. The organisation sought a flexible and intuitive platform that would enhance IT service delivery, improve self-service capabilities, and streamline IT operations across its multiple departments and teams.
Xcession partnered with the Trust to implement Xurrent, a leading ITSM platform, using a phased approach to ensure minimal disruption and maximum efficiency. The transformation focused on delivering a robust ITSM foundation, improving automation, and empowering in-house teams through a coached implementation strategy.
Challenges
The NHS Trust faced several IT service management challenges, including:
- An ageing ITSM platform that no longer met operational needs.
- A large IT support team (80-100 specialists) managing services for 12,000 employees across clinical and non-clinical functions.
- Limited automation and manual service request handling, leading to inefficiencies.
- A need for better asset and configuration management to track IT resources effectively.
- The requirement for a self-service portal to improve end-user experience and reduce service desk workloads.
